The owner of a vibrant city beauty salon is celebrating a "challenging but rewarding" first year in business. 

Kelly-Anne Williams opened the doors to Simply Beauty near Norwich Market in Guildhall Hill in May 2023, stunning guests with its pink decor and quirky neon signage.  

The salon initially only offered manicures but has already expanded by building a new beauty room for pedicures, lashes, tinting, HD brows, laminated brows, massages and facials.

"It's been a really challenging but rewarding year for us," Miss Williams said. 

"I'm proud of what we've managed to do here - the hardest part has been getting our name out there. 

"We've listened to what our clients want and made the necessary changes and we've been a lot busier since."

She added one of her highlights of the past year has been running a pop-up nail bar in John Lewis, which she called "an amazing opportunity".  

The owner expects the next year to be just as lively - with her premises contract running out in November, she will be searching for a new home in the city alongside continuing to treat her "very loyal client base". 

Miss Williams hopes to one day incorporate aspects of her previous career into her business.

She worked in different Imagine Spa locations across the region for 12 years before opening Simply Beauty and managed her own team for seven of those years. 

"What we do at the moment is make people feel really lovely and nice, getting them ready for events and holidays," she added. 

"But in a hotel spa, there is more of a focus on relaxation which I really enjoyed so I'd love to get back into that later on.”
